Third Party and Independent
Nader Ballot Access
Nader supporters established
the Populist Party, a "limited political party" which "organizes for the
purpose of selecting candidates for electors for President and Vice President
of the United States." [AS 15.60.010(13) and 15.30.025] This
required submission of 2,878 valid signatures by August 4. The campaign
submitted signatures on August 4 and the Division of Elections verified
more than 3,000 signatures on September 2.

Candidate Visits
Nader
July 20-21, 2004 in Anchorage,
AK
July 20 - Interview with
Anchorage Press (weekly newspaper) at their office on E. 5th Ave.
Press conference at Cyrano's Bookstore and Off-center Playhouse.
Picnic at Valley of the Moon Park. Interview with AP. KBYR
AM Radio Talk Show with Dan Fagan. Fundraiser at private home.
Fundraiser at private home.
July 21 - Meeting with volunteers,
book signing at Electica. Media interviews. Dinner with Jim
Sykes, Green candidate for U.S. Senate, at Organic Oasis. Speech
and rally at First United Methodist Church auditorium.
